Understanding Citric Acid: A Comprehensive Overview

Citric acid, known chemically as C₆H₈O₇ and labeled in the food industry as E330, is a naturally occurring organic compound. It belongs to the alpha-hydroxy acid (AHA) family, celebrated for its diverse applications and safety. Comprehensive Comparison: Food Grade vs. Industrial Grade Sodium Bicarbonate

Sodium bicarbonate (NaHCO₃), commonly known as baking soda, is a versatile compound with a wide range of applications in industries, households, and food preparation. Its functionality, purity, and intended use define its classification into two main grades: food grade and industrial grade.
